Hotlinking is a largely accepted Internet term for linking to another website’s images. To put it differently, if you create a site, somebody else may want to use the images which you have and instead of downloading them from your site and then uploading them to their website, they can simply put links to your Internet site. This way, each time a visitor opens their site, the images will be loaded from your account, consequently stealing from your own monthly traffic quota, not to mention the copyright problems which may present themselves or that someone may be trying to trick people into thinking that they are in fact on your site. In rare situations, documents and other types of files may also be linked in the exact same way. To stop this from happening and to avoid this sort of situations, you may enable hotlink protection for your Internet site.
